Roland DG complements its UV line-up with LSINC as global distribution partner

Hits: 164

Roland DG Corporation has announced a new worldwide distribution partnership with LSINC Corporation that it claims ‘will significantly widen access to LSINC’s industrial direct-to-object printing technologies’. Under the agreement, Roland DG becomes an official global distributor of LSINC’s Peri-series of high-volume cylindrical object printers, extending a successful regional collaboration into a comprehensive global strategy.

Epson SureColor G9060 enhances DTF productivity

Hits: 313

Epson has introduced its first expansion of the SureColor G-Series wide-format dedicated direct-to-film (DTFilm) printer line with the SureColor G9060. The 64-inch SureColor G9060 – big brother to the popular SureColor G6060 - has been engineered for reliable, non-stop performance, consistent colour and minimal maintenance so that garment producers and print shop owners can focus on creating high-quality apparel and merchandise.

Heidelberg revamps financing for growth

Hits: 556

Heidelberger Druckmaschinen AG (Heidelberg) has agreed a new €436m (c. $760m) loan facility with a consortium of banks, to support its growth plans and strategic developments.This replaces the previous €370m syndicated credit line that was agreed in 2023 and was due to mature in 2028.

Mimaki TS330 Series upgrades include extended colour gamut and larger print width

Hits: 407

Mimaki Europe has announced enhancements to its dye sublimation TS330 Series, including the introduction of the TS330-1800 - able to accommodate single-piece, wide textile fabrics, ideal for larger home décor applications – as well as making the entire TS330 Series compatible with Mimaki’s Sb411 inks in Orange, Violet, Fluorescent Pink and Fluorescent Yellow.

Roland DG TY-300 DTF printer enjoys significant upgrade

Hits: 413

Roland DG Corporation has announced a series of engineering and performance updates to the TY-300 Direct-to-Film (DTF) printer, designed to support high-duty-cycle apparel production. The enhanced TY-300 now features increased ink system capacity, improved white ink stability and new workflow optimisations.
